site stats

Count set bits in c++ stl

WebNov 27,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ebJul 12,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Count set bits in an integer - GeeksforGeeks

WebJun 3, 2024 · Before we describe this function, can you think of a solution to the problem: “Count Set bits in a given. Continue reading. June 3, ... C++ STL Tutorial : Most frequent used STL Containers/Algorithms. What is C++ STL? C++ is one of the most popular high-level programming language which is used extensively for a. Continue reading. June 3, … WebUse the bitwise OR operator ( ) to set a bit. number = 1UL << n; That will set the n th bit of number. n should be zero, if you want to set the 1 st bit and so on upto n-1, if you want to set the n th bit. Use 1ULL if number is wider than unsigned long; promotion of 1UL << n doesn't happen until after evaluating 1UL << n where it's undefined ... motorehead 1000 bearbrick https://voicecoach4u.com

sort() in C++ STL - Tutorial - takeuforward

WebJun 3, 2024 · The solution works as follows: Until the given number is greater than zero, that is, until all bits in the number is not set to 0. Keep on doing bitwise AND with the number … WebA bitset stores bits (elements with only two possible values: 0 or 1, true or false, ...). The class emulates an array of bool elements, but optimized for space allocation: generally, … WebCourses. For Working Professionals. Data Structure & Algorithm Classes (Live) System Design (Live) DevOps(Live) Explore More Live Courses; For Students motorella waibstadt

Count set bits in an integer in C - tutorialspoint.com

Category:Find the Number of 1 Bits in a large Binary Number in C++

Tags:Count set bits in c++ stl

Count set bits in c++ stl

Count total bits in a number in C++ - TutorialsPoint

WebJan 27, 2024 · std:: bitset. The class template bitset represents a fixed-size sequence of N bits. Bitsets can be manipulated by standard logic operators and converted to and from … WebJul 12,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and …

Count set bits in c++ stl

Did you know?

WebMar 5, 2024 · What is set::count ()? count () function is an inbuilt function in C++ STL, which is defined in header file. count () is used to count the number of times an … WebMay 8, 2014 · I write a program with highly memory cost requirement and I want save memory with no performance lost. So I want change every variable which has only two situations into bit. But I can't find bit type in C++ and bitset in STL is always multiples of 4 byte in 32-bit machine. Writing a data struct to manage bits will cause performance lost.

WebDec 21, 2015 · This C++ gets g++ to emit very good ... member function to get the count of bits set in the result. As for creating the mask: you can shift 1 left N places, then subtract … WebJul 24, 2024 · initial value: 00010010 setting bit 0: 00010011 setting bit 2: 00010111 See also. size

WebGCC also provides two other built-in functions, int __builtin_popcountl (unsigned long) and int __builtin_popcountll (unsigned long long), similar to __builtin_popcount, except their argument type is unsigned long and unsigned long long, respectively. 4. Using std::bitset::count function. We can also use std::bitset::count that returns the total … WebIn this article, we have explored about __builtin_popcount - a built-in function of GCC, which helps us to count the number of 1's (set bits) in an integer in C and C++. POPCNT is the assemby instruction used in __builtin_popcount. The population count (or popcount) of a specific value is the number of set bits in that value.

WebApr 9,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ebJan 26, 2011 · The Algorithm that we follow is to count all the bits that are set to 1. Now if we want to count through that bitset for a number n, we would go through log (n)+1 digits. For example: for the number 13, we get 1101 as the bitset. Natural log of 13 = 2.564 (approximately) 3 Number of bits = 3+1 = 4 For any number n (decimal) we loop log … motoren aus chinaWebNov 21, 2014 · It takes advantage of the fact that adding bits in binary is completely independent of the position of the bit and the sum is never more than 2 bits. 00+00=00, 00+01=01, 01+00=01, 01+01=10. motoren boonstraWebJun 3, 2024 · The sort () function in STL accepts two mandatory parameters: begin, and end, and sorts the range with-in the container in ascending order by default. sort (begin, end) begin: It is an iterator pointing to the first element of a container. end: It is an iterator pointing to element just after the last element of the container. Example 1: motoreasy motWebApr 19, 2024 · Functions in set: insert () – to insert an element in the set. begin () – return an iterator pointing to the first element in the set. end () – returns an iterator to the theoretical element after the last element. count () – returns true or false based on whether the element is present in the set or not. motoren drentheWebMar 5,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… motoren amriswilmotoren bmw x1WebApr 12, 2024 · C++ 常用语法——un ordered _ set. LiuXF93的博客. 1万+. 一、 使用 前提 引入头文件: #include 二、un ordered _ set 是什么 un ordered _ … motoren choppers